This is where you create a mail form for your customers to contact you through.

First click on "New E-mail form" This will open a new page displaying a few properties that need to be filled in.

Type in the name of this form in the label section and then enter the email address you want the mail to go to and the email subject.

This section must be filled in or customer won't know where email has come from or where to reply to.

Specify what the submit button will display, for example "Send" or "Submit" and then specify the destination where the customer will end up after he has clicked on the link.

Next, you add the content of your forms from using Input fields or free text box. These are displayed on the left of your customer input box.

There are three types you can choose;

Feature

What it does

Text

This is used when you want a field to plain text. Can be used to allow your customer to enter phone numbers, names, email, etc. The number of columns determines the width and number of lines determines the height of the field that the customer can write in.

Select

Used to create drop down menu with per-determined choices, In values, type in the options to select. You separate the options with the return key.

CheckBox

Used to create a tick box.

You can then add this email form by going to Documents -> Documents. Select the page you want the form to be shown in. Then select "Add element" and then e-mail form. Browse to the form that you created and click "Save content".

The products section allows you to not only browse details of all products from feeds, but also create & modify custom products.

Feature

What it does

Part number

Search for the exact part number.

Manufacturer

Search for products by a specific manufacturer.

SKU

Search for products with a specific Stock Keeping Unit.

Name

Find products with this search field in their name.

Price in

Find products with a specific cost price.

Etailer-id

The Etailer-id is globally unique in Nettailer & matches specific products to their CNet data. This should only return a single product.

Part of searchwords

Select this if you want to view any partial matches.

Type

This allows you to search only for products which have OPG prices.

Has CNet info

Find products with CNet information.

Categorized

Find products which have category & sub category information.

Distributor

Find products from a specific distributor.

Created after

Find products created after a specific date

Doubles

Find products which are available from multiple places.

Create/Edit product

At the top of the page are 5 links. These links will be greyed out for products which are from a data feed.

Link

What it does

Edit

Opens the product for editing.

Make copy

Duplicates the product so you can create a similar product with different defining details.

Delete

Delete the product.

(minus)

Warning
This is irreversable - so be completely sure that you want to do this!

 

Clear CNet information

If the product has been matched with CNet information, it will show in the fields. However, if you want to replace the CNet info & replace it with something bespoke, you can do.

Show product in store

Takes you directly to the product in your webstore.

Fields with an asterisk* are mandatory. Products cannot be created unless these fields contain data.

Feature

What it does

Active

If the product is active, it is visible in the store. Removing the tick box from here means you can work on a product without customers being able to see it.

Internal

Selecting this means that customers won't be able to see the product, but users with Admin or Seller rights will be able to.

Created date

Date stamp of when the product was created in the Nettailer database.

Part number

The manufacturers part number.

SKU

The SKU used to reference the product.

Name

The name of the product.

Name extension

Additional naming details.

EAN

The European Article Number (EAN) or Universal Part Code (UPC).

Price

The cost price of the product - excluding VAT.

Tax

Select if the product is VAT applicable or not.

Internal quantity in stock

Enable this if you have stock in your warehouse.

Quantity in stock

How much stock you want the system to show.

Sorting

Set the sorting priority. Lower numbers attract a higher priority.

Description

The product description.

Spec

The spec for the product.

(warning)

Be Careful
If you want the specification to appear in a table, use the 'Spec' tab at the top of the page instead.

 

Distributor

Select which distributor the product is from. If you're creating you're own product, select 'Nettailer'.

Manufacturer

The name of the manufacturer.

Category

What category & sub-category the product belongs to.

Product Family

What product family the product should be grouped with.

Condition

Is the product new, refurbished or just plain 2nd hand.

Import

Feature

What it does

Don't import product information

Enabling this will prevent Nettailer from using any CNet data, even if it exists.

Protect name at import

Enabling this will prevent Nettailer from overwriting the product name with CNet information.

Protect description during import

Enabling this will prevent Nettailer from overwriting the product description with CNet information.

Protect specification during import

Enabling this will prevent Nettailer from overwriting the product specification with CNet information.

Protect against removal by import

Enabling this will make it impossible to delete the product by entering a 'd' into the first column of a product import.

Spec

The spec tab allows you to create the technical specification for a product in a table.
Just click Add & fill in the values. Lines can be hidden by deselecting 'Active'. Lines can also be sorted by adjusting the 'Sorting' - lower numbers will appear at the top of the list.
